Role of the Slug Transcription Factor in Chemically-Induced Skin Cancer
The Slug transcription factor plays an important role in ultraviolet radiation (UVR)-induced skin carcinogenesis, particularly in the epithelial-mesenchymal transition (EMT) occurring during tumor progression.
